Ray Morehart was born December 2, 1899, in Abner, TX, USA.
Ray Morehart died January 13, 1989, in Dallas, TX, USA.

Ray Morehart is 5 feet 9 inches tall. He weighs 157 pounds. He bats left and throws right.

Ray Morehart debuted on August 9, 1924, playing for the Chicago White Sox at Comiskey Park; he played his final game on September 29, 1927, playing for the New York Yankees at Yankee Stadium I.

Ray Morehart played in 2 games at second base for the Chicago White Sox in 1924, starting in none of them. He made 4 putouts, had 2 assists, and committed one error, equivalent to .5 errors per game (estimate based on total games played in). He had no double plays.
Ray Morehart played in 27 games at short stop for the Chicago White Sox in 1924, starting in none of them. He made 35 putouts, had 68 assists, and committed 15 errors, equivalent to .556 errors per game (estimate based on total games played in). He had 12 double plays.
Ray Morehart played in 48 games at second base for the Chicago White Sox in 1926, starting in none of them. He made 71 putouts, had 136 assists, and committed 11 errors, equivalent to .229 errors per game (estimate based on total games played in). He had 13 double plays.
Ray Morehart played in 53 games at second base for the New York Yankees in 1927, starting in none of them. He made 101 putouts, had 175 assists, and committed 16 errors, equivalent to .302 errors per game (estimate based on total games played in). He had 27 double plays.
